Enrique Salaices is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Catalysis and Ocean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Enrique Salaices has authored 7 papers receiving a total of 404 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 3 papers in Catalysis and 2 papers in Ocean Engineering. Recurrent topics in Enrique Salaices's work include Thermochemical Biomass Conversion Processes (4 papers), Catalysts for Methane Reforming (3 papers) and Subcritical and Supercritical Water Processes (3 papers). Enrique Salaices is often cited by papers focused on Thermochemical Biomass Conversion Processes (4 papers), Catalysts for Methane Reforming (3 papers) and Subcritical and Supercritical Water Processes (3 papers). Enrique Salaices collaborates with scholars based in Mexico and Canada. Enrique Salaices's co-authors include Hugo de Lasa, Jahirul Ahmed Mazumder, Rahima A. Lucky, Benito Serrano, Juan Carlos Ramos, A. Hernández, M. Hernández, Cesare Miranda, A. García and A. Garcı́a and has published in prestigious journals such as Chemical Reviews, Industrial & Engineering Chemistry Research and AIChE Journal.
